A 17 ) November 24, 1993 TO: Mayor and Members of the City Council FROM: Robert O. Malm, Interim City Manager SUBJECT: Increased Fees for Citations PURPOSE To forward for Council consideration a proposed ordinance amendment regarding increased fees for citations . BACKGROUND At the meeting with the City Council on November 20, 1993, the Department of Code Administration proposed raising the administrative citation fee from $10 . 00 ($25 . 00 late fee) to $25 .00 ($50 . 00 late fee) . The attached ordinance amendment will accomplish the purpose. The Department of Code Administration currently spends approx- imately $15,000 annually in administering housing complaint citations . The revenue generated in 1993, although the larg- est since the program was initiated, is expected to be $7 , 180 . This fee does not cover any of the costs of the inspection. FINANCIAL IMPACT If the same number of initial citations and late citations are issued in 1994 as in 1993 (318 and 160, respectively) , a total revenue of $15,950 will be generated. RECOMMENDATION That the City Council adopt the proposed amendment. /� . Ro-ert • . alm Interim City Manager
